rtsp rtp-seq
This command defines a rule definition to analyze and charge user traffic based on sequence ―seq‖ field in the RTP-Info
header of the RTSP message.

Usage
Use this command to specify a rule definition to analyze user traffic matching the sequence ‘seq‘ field in the
RTP-Info header of the RTSP response for a PLAY request.
